WARRENSBURG, Mo. (Feb. 13, 2020) - Central Missouri Wrestling will compete in two MIAA duals on the road this weekend. These are the Mules final duals before the NCAA Super Regional IV beginning the first of March.

Mat Notes:
• Central Missouri's duals against Newman and Central Oklahoma are the Mules final duals of the season.
• Newman has three wins on the season over Chadron State, New Mexico Highlands and Maryville.
• The Jets have two individually ranked wrestlers. Tyler Lawley is ranked seventh at 133 pounds and Kameron Frame is currently ranked 10th at 157 pounds.
• Central Oklahoma is currently ranked sixth in Division II wrestling. The Bronchos have five individual ranked wrestlers lead by their top-ranked 184 pounder, Heath Gray. Ty Lucans is ranked third in 157 pounds, Tanner Cole is ranked fifth at 125 pounds, Dalton Abney is ranked sixth at 197 pounds and Dayton Garrett ranks seventh at 165 pounds.
• The No. 6 Bronchos only dual losses this season were to No. 1 St. Cloud State (12-22) and No. 2 McKendree (12-20).
Series History:
• Friday night's dual against the Jets will be Central Missouri and Newman's 16th meeting. The Mules lead the all-time series 11-4 and have won five of the last six match ups.
• Sunday afternoon's match up against the Bronchos will the Central Missouri and Central Oklahoma's 41st dual meeting. The Bronchos lead the all-time series 40-0.
Mules Feed:
• Central Missouri has lost four of their seven duals to top-25 teams in Division II.
• The Mules are lead by senior 133 pounder
John Feeney with a season record of 19-12.
• Feeney was UCM's only national qualifier last season at 133 pounds. Feeney took second in the 2019 NCAA Super Regional as the Mules earned a seventh place team finish.
